STATE LICENSE FEE ACT (EXCERPT) Act 152 of 1979 338.2210 Correcting records and issuing new document; fee. Sec.

10.The department may charge a $10.00 fee for correcting its records and issuing a new document when a person notifies the department of a change of name, address, or employer. If the change does not require the issuance of a new document, no charge shall be made for correcting the department's records.
